swaver
\\ˈswāvə(r)\ intransitive verb
Etymology: Middle English swaveren, perhaps of Scandinavian origin; akin to Norwegian dail, sveiva to swing, Old Norse sveifla to swing, spin, svīfa to rove, ramble, drift — more at swivel
dialect Britain : stagger
